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Our team will assess the extent of the water damage and identify the source of the leak. We'll use specialized equipment to detect any hidden moisture and find out the best course of action.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using advanced equipment, we'll extract the water from the walls and surrounding areas, reducing the risk of mold growth and structural dam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ected areas, ensuring that your property is completely dry and free of moisture.
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ction
Once the drying process is complete, our team will repair and reconstruct any damaged areas, including walls, ceilings, and floors.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is completely restored to its original condition. We'll also provide a thorough cleaning of the affected areas to leave your home looking and feeling like new.

Wall Water Damage Repair Cost in Bedford Heights, OH
The cost of wall water damage rep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bedford Heights, OH. Our estimates are based on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 - $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 - $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the amount of equipment needed. |
| Repair and reconstruction | $2,000 - $10,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of materials needed. |
| Final inspection and cleaning | $500 - $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of cleaning required. |
| Emergency services | $1,000 - $5,000 | The time of day and the urgency of the situation. |
| More services | $500 - $2,000 | The type and scope of more services required. |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and are happy to discuss your specific situation and provide a customized quote.
